This is a close-up, low-angle, vertical shot of ornate, reddish-orange carvings that appear to be made of wood or stucco, situated inside a building. The primary subject is a pillar adorned with intricately carved figures. At the top of the pillar, a large, muscular, grotesque figure with a fierce expression and a headdress is depicted in a dynamic pose, with one hand raised to its head, supporting the structure above. Below this figure, another carved human-like figure is positioned in a kneeling or supporting stance, its body also elaborately decorated. The pillar itself is a masterpiece of carving, featuring detailed patterns and mythical creatures. To the sides of the pillar, arched doorways or alcoves are visible, also filled with detailed carvings. These include what appear to be serpentine forms, possibly naga, and smaller human-like figures in prayer or worship. The ceiling above the pillar has decorative circular elements, some with what look like embedded lights or ornamentation. The walls of the building, also painted in a reddish-orange hue, show some signs of wear, with streaks and smudges. The style of the carvings is indicative of traditional Thai temple or religious architecture. The specific location in Baan Hua Thanon, Thailand, suggests a connection to Buddhist or Hindu influences prevalent in the region. The overall impression is one of grand, artistic decoration within a sacred or culturally significant space.
